Transaction ef20c367ddfec517f4f7f5f52e85cc348176295c64a0cc77d5f0a85b634e45a0

6 Input
2 Outputs
  • ef20c367ddfec517f4f7f5f52e85cc348176295c64a0cc77d5f0a85b634e45a0:0
  • value  25000000
    address  14au7qq44o7H9sFtdUP4EPmry8zEV98oBf
  • ef20c367ddfec517f4f7f5f52e85cc348176295c64a0cc77d5f0a85b634e45a0:1
  • value  1007795
    address  bc1q09f58pagdjx5xxmcsseqxneln0fn3wydhcvjfm